首先,我们来看一个简单的例子,在JavaScript中定义一个函数:
function helloWorld() {
alert("Hello, World!");
}
上面的代码定义了一个名为helloWorld的函数,它的功能是弹出一个警告框,显示“Hello, World!”这个字符串。现在我们可以调用这个函数:
helloWorld();
当我们调用helloWorld函数时,它会运行函数体中的代码,显示一个警告框,让我们看到“Hello, World!”这个字符串。
在JavaScript中,我们还可以定义带参数的函数。下面是一个带参数的例子:
function greet(name) {
alert("Hello, " + name + "!");
}
这个函数名为greet,它有一个参数name。函数体中的代码使用这个参数来构造一个字符串,然后在警告框中显示它。现在我们可以调用这个函数,向它提供一个参数:
greet("John");
当我们调用greet并向它提供一个参数时,它会运行函数体中的代码,使用提供的参数来构造一个字符串,并在警告框中显示它。在这个例子中,警告框会显示“Hello, John!”这个字符串。
在JavaScript中,还有一种特殊的函数,称为匿名函数。它没有名字,但仍然可以像任何其他函数一样使用。下面是一个匿名函数的例子:
var add = function(a, b) {
return a + b;
};
这个函数没有名字,但它被赋值给了一个变量add。在函数体中,它使用参数a和b来计算它们的和,并使用return关键字返回结果。现在我们可以调用这个函数:
var result = add(2, 3);
alert(result);
当我们调用add函数时,它会计算提供的参数的和,并将结果返回给调用方。在这个例子中,我们计算2和3的和,并将结果存储在变量result中,然后在警告框中显示它。在这个例子中,警告框会显示“5”这个数字。
总结一下,在JavaScript中定义函数是一个非常重要的操作。我们可以定义简单的函数,也可以定义带参数的函数和匿名函数。无论函数有多复杂,定义函数都是一个非常有用的工具,可帮助我们将代码分解成独立的模块,使代码更易于理解和维护。
上一篇:javascript中可以实现方法重载
下一篇:css按钮样式如何设置









